When it comes to wound care, the ankle-brachial index (ABI) is more than just a number; it's a sign, a guiding star, if you will, that directs nurses toward the right treatment options. So, at what ABI value is modified compression therapy considered only if needed? Here's the straightforward answer: when the ABI is between ≤ 0.60 - 0.80, that's your caution zone. You know what? Understanding ABI is crucial, especially when dealing with patients suffering from conditions like peripheral artery disease (PAD). This simple test measures the blood flow to the legs and can indicate how vital your decisions about compression therapy might be. In the ABI range of 0.60 and 0.80, there’s a hint of arterial compromise. It's like standing on the edge of a pool, cautiously weighing your options. This range means the risks and benefits of using modified compression therapy need careful evaluation.

Let's contrast this with other ABI ranges for clarity. If the ABI is ≤ 0.90, you’re likely looking at a more significant arterial compromise, which typically makes compression therapy a no-go—risky territory, for sure. Patients with an ABI of ≥ 1.30 often display calcified arteries, potentially requiring entirely different interventions; compression may not even be on the table!
